Pros

Usually easygoing, allows work-life balance - usually no overtime or stress. People are generally nice and supportive. Administration works flawlessly.

Cons

Projects are generally not very interesting to develop and release cycles are longer than a year. Pivots in products are common. Hardly any bonuses or salary hikes. No investment in UI/UX, probably because the target market is not consumers but rather enterprises.
